Schülerprojekt 2001 / 2002 Ansteuerung eines Bearbeitungszentrums mittels SPS Betreuer: WOLMERING Claude
BASTIAN Marc Das Projekt besteht aus einem elektropneumatischen Bearbeitungszentrum und einem Knickarmroboter Beide sollen jeweils über eine SPS angesteuert werden Die Ansteuerung soll manuell und automatisch ausführbar sein.
BASTIAN Marc MANUELLER BETRIEB Die Bearbeitungszentrale kann über Taster resp. Stellschalter an dem Steuerpult in Betrieb gebracht werden Der Roboter kann mit Hilfe eines ASCII- Hand-Held-Programmiergerät gesteuert werden
BASTIAN Marc AUTOMATISCHER BETRIEB Das Bearbeitungszentrum stempelt 7 Chips Diese werden mittels eines Förderbandes zur Abnahmeposition gefahren Der Roboter nimmt diese Chips auf und transportiert sie in den Container Der Ablauf ist durchgeführt
BASTIAN Marc UNSERE ARBEIT WAR ES IN 1. PHASE: Bearbeitungszentrum, Förderband und Roboter zu verkabeln und mit den 2 SPS zu verbinden Steuerpult herstellen und anschließen Netzteil und Anpassungsschaltung herstellen Komplette Anlage auf einer Demonstrations-platte aufbauen Beide SPS miteinander verbinden
BASTIAN Marc UNSERE ARBEIT WAR ES IN 2. PHASE: Programmierung des Bearbeitungszentrums Programmierung des Förderbandes Programmierung des Roboters Mit Hilfe einer Prozessvisualisierungssoftware sollen die Signalzustände der Gesamtanlage graphisch dargestellt werden
BASTIAN Marc AUFBAU DES BEARBEITUNGSZENTRUMS:
DICHTER Charles Der Roboter Aufgabe: Chips vom Förderband in den Container ablegen
DICHTER Charles Der Roboter Anforderungen: 360 Drehen Vorwärts und Rückwärts fahren Heben und Senken des Armes Öffnen und Schliessen der Zange
Der Roboter DICHTER Charles
Anschluss an der SPS DICHTER Charles
Die Relaisplatine DICHTER Charles
DICHTER Charles Die Relaisplatine Motor in Rechtslauf
DICHTER Charles Die Relaisplatine Motor in Linkslauf
Spannungsstabilisiertes Netzteil PRUMBAUM Laurent
Steuerpult PRUMBAUM Laurent
OLINGER Luc DATENTRANSFER ZWISCHEN 2 SPS: Die SPS werden über das RS485 Port miteinander verbunden Erste SPS wird als Parent-SPS definiert Einstellungen der Parent-SPS:
OLINGER Luc DATENTRANSFER ZWISCHEN 2 SPS: Zweite SPS wird als Child-SPS definiert Einstellungen der Child-SPS:
DATENTRANSFER ZWISCHEN 2 SPS: Prinzip des Datentransfers OLINGER Luc PARENT-SPS SPS-1 CHILD-SPS SPS-2 Eingangsworte Ausgangsworte Eingangsworte Ausgangsworte 10305 00305 10305 00305 10306 00306 10306 00306
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 1.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 2.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 3.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 4.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 5.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 6.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 7.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 8.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 9.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 10.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 11.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 12.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 13. Schritt:
OLINGER Luc TYPISCHER VERARBEITUNGSWEG EINES CHIPS : 14. Schritt:
HENSCHEN Stéphane Programm des Bearbeitungszentrums
HENSCHEN Stéphane BETRIEBSMODEN Manueller Modus: Drehschalter S1 auf Manuell Automatischer Modus: Drehschalter S1 auf Automatik Fernbetrieb Modus: Drehschalter S1 auf Fernbetrieb
HENSCHEN Stéphane
HENSCHEN Stéphane
HENSCHEN Stéphane
HENSCHEN Stéphane
PRUMBAUM Laurent Programm des Förderband
1. Schritt Auflegen des Chips auf das Förderband Start PRUMBAUM Laurent Ein lesen vom Drehschalter Automatik? Nein Ja W arten Chip runter von Drehscheibe Chip auf Band? Ja 2sek Verzögerung Nein Start Förderband Ein lesen Lichtschranke Chip durch Lichtschranke? Ja Zähler 11 Schritte Nein Einlesen von Drehschalter Zälh er auf Null? Band stoppt Ja Nein Band frei? Ja Nein
2. Schritt Auflegen des Chips auf das Förderband Start PRUMBAUM Laurent Ein lesen vom Drehschalter Automatik? Nein Ja W arten Chip runter von Drehscheibe Chip auf Band? Ja 2sek Verzögerung Nein Start Förderband Ein lesen Lichtschranke Chip durch Lichtschranke? Ja Zähler 11 Schritte Nein Einlesen von Drehschalter Zälh er auf Null? Band stoppt Ja Nein Band frei? Ja Nein
3. Schritt Chip läuft durch die Lichtschranke Start PRUMBAUM Laurent Ein lesen vom Drehschalter Automatik? Nein Ja W arten Chip runter von Drehscheibe Chip auf Band? Ja 2sek Verzögerung Nein Start Förderband Ein lesen Lichtschranke Chip durch Lichtschranke? Ja Zähler 11 Schritte Nein Einlesen von Drehschalter Zälh er auf Null? Band stoppt Ja Nein Band frei? Ja Nein
4. Schritt Entnehmen des Chips durch den Roboter Start PRUMBAUM Laurent Ein lesen vom Drehschalter Automatik? Nein Ja W arten Chip runter von Drehscheibe Chip auf Band? Ja 2sek Verzögerung Nein Start Förderband Ein lesen Lichtschranke Chip durch Lichtschranke? Ja Zähler 11 Schritte Nein Einlesen von Drehschalter Zälh er auf Null? Band stoppt Ja Nein Band frei? Ja Nein
WILDSCHÜTZ Yves Programm des Roboters
Handprogrammiergerät HHP WILDSCHÜTZ Yves Für Manuellbetrieb des Roboters 1 Roboter links drehen 2 Roboter rechts drehen 4 Roboter senken 7 Roboter heben 5 Roboter zurückfahren 8 Roboter Vorfahren 6 Zange schliessen 9 Zange öffnen LCD Display Tastenfeld zur Manuellen Bedienung des Roboters 3 Fahre in Home Position
Flussdiagramm Für Manuellbetrieb START SPS1 Manuellbetrieb? Befehl von HHP einlesen Alle Ausgänge aus Taste 0 betätigt? A Rob. rechts drehen Taste 1 betätigt? Rob. links drehen Taste 2 betätigt? Rob. in HP fahren Taste 3 betätigt? Rob. senken Taste 4 betätigt? Rob. zurückfahren Taste 5 betätigt? Rob. vorfahren Taste 6 betätigt? Rob. heben Taste 7 betätigt? Zange schliessen Taste 8 betätigt? Zange öffnen Taste 9 betätigt?
Flussdiagramm D A WILDSCHÜTZ Yves Für Automatikbetrieb SPS 1 in Automatik/Fernbetrieb? S1 betätigt? C Roboter in HP Chip bereit? Fahre in HP Zähler Drehscheibe = 0 Zähler Heben/senken = 0 Zähler vor/rück = 0 Scheibe rechts drehen Arm heben Arm vorfahren Zähler Zange = 0 Motor Zange schliessen Rest Zähler B
Flussdiagramm Für Automatikbetrieb B Neue Zählerwerte einlesen Band <=> Container WILDSCHÜTZ Yves Zähler Drehseibe = 0 Zähler Heben/senken = 0 Zähler vor/rück = 0 Scheibe links drehen Arm senken Arm zurückfahren Zähler Zange = 0 Motor Zange öffnen Zähler SPS 1 incrementieren Zähler SPS 1 = 7? Roboter in HP fahren Rest Zähler SPS 2 D C
Flussdiagramm D A WILDSCHÜTZ Yves Für Automatikbetrieb SPS 1 in Automatik/Fernbetrieb? S1 betätigt? C Roboter in HP Chip bereit? Fahre in HP Zähler Drehscheibe = 0 Zähler Heben/senken = 0 Zähler vor/rück = 0 Scheibe rechts drehen Arm heben Arm vorfahren Zähler Zange = 0 Motor Zange schliessen Rest Zähler B